文深入研究複雜資料類
在程式設計領域,數據是應用程式的命脈。雖然整數和字串等簡單資料類型充當構建塊,但複雜資料類型為表示複雜資訊提供了更豐富的調色板。本型的世界,探討它們的重要性、常見類型和實際應用。
了解複雜資料類型
與簡單的資料類型不同,複雜的資料類型可讓您將多個值或物件封裝在一個結構中。它們提供了一種更有組織、更有效的方法來處理複雜的資料結構。
複雜資料類型的主要特徵:
- 複合:它們由多個資料元素組成。
- 結構:它們具有明確的內部結構。
- 靈活性:它們可以容納各種資料類型。
常見的複雜資料類型
-
數組:
- 相同資料類型的元素的有序集合。
- 非常適合儲存值清單或相關資料。
- 範例:整數、字串或物件的陣列。
-
結構(或記錄):
- 異質資料元素的集合,每個 行業電子郵件列表 元素都有自己的資料類型和識別碼。
- 用於表示具有多個屬性的現實世界實體。
- 範例:客戶記錄、員工資料、產品詳細資料。
-
類別(物件導向程式設計):
- 用於建立具有屬性和方法的物件的藍圖。
- 封裝資料和行為。
- 作為物件導向程式設計的基礎。
- 範例:客戶類別、產品類別、訂單類別。
雜資料類型的應用
複雜資料類型在各領域都有應用:
- 資料科學:表示 弗瑞奥萨疯狂的麦克斯传奇由 資料集、執行複雜計算、建立機器學習模型。
- Web 開發:建立動態網頁、儲存使用者資料和管理資料庫。
- 遊戲開發:儲存遊戲物件、玩家資訊和遊戲世界資料。
- 軟體工程:設計資料結構以實現高效的演算法和資料管理。
選擇正確的複雜資料類型
選擇適當的複雜資料類型取決於您的應用程式的特定要求。考慮以下因素:
- 數據組織:數據應該如何建構?
- 存取模式:如何存取和修改資料?
- 效能:資料結構的預期效能是什麼?
- 記憶體使用:資料結構會消耗多少記憶體?
透過了解複雜資料類型及其應用程式的細微差別,您可以建立更有效率、更強大且可擴展的軟體系統。
關鍵字:複雜資料類型、陣列、結構、類別、鍊錶、樹、圖、資料結構、程式設計、資料科學、Web 開發、遊戲開發、軟體工程
您想更深入地研究特定的複雜資料類型或其應用程式嗎?